Harding Lawson Associates (HLA) is pleased to <br />transmit this report which details a proposed work plan for treatment of gasoline <br />containing soil at Forward Landfill in Stockton, California. This work plan was <br />prepared in response to recent air quality regulations concerning uncontrolled emissions <br />effective in July 1991. <br />In order to meet project schedules and take advantage of summer weather conditions, <br />we respectfully request your comments on this work plan at your earliest convenience. <br />It is the intent of Forward and HLA to begin construction of the treatment units as <br />soon as possible so that treatment activities can commence by October 1, 1991. <br />We trust this is the information that you require at this time.
